2013: Played in all 11 games ... Snapped the ball to Stephen Doar, allowing him to get 58 punts off with none being blocked … Doar averaged 37.9 yard per punt, with 17 hitting inside the 20-yard line, 3 over 50 yards and 19 resulting in fair catches ... Posted a tackle against Liberty, Coastal Carolina and Charlotte ... Forced a fumble against the Chanticleers as well ...
2012: Played in all 11 games at long snapper ... Started against Brevard as the long snapper ... Enabled punter Patrick Morgano to average 38.2 yards in his four punts ... Played at Georgia Tech, helped the punter hit nine punts, averaging 38.2 yards, two of which were inside the 20-yard line ... Posted two solo tackles at Vanderbilt as the starter at the long snapper spot ... Long snapper against Furman and Davidson, posting no stats ... Also played at VMI and Liberty, helping Morgano hit eight punts, including a career-long 69 yard punt against the Flames ... Helped Morgano post nine punts for 352 yards (39.1 avg.) against Charleston Southern ... Also recorded a catch against the Bucs for nine yards ...
2011: Served as long snapper for the Blue Hose all season and enabled Patrick Morgano to successfully punt away 66 times, with only three of them blocked.
High School: ... Attended Conway HS and played football for Chuck Jordan ... Varsity starter for three years as a strong safety, long and short snapper ... Recorded 79 tackles, five TFLs, one interception (a 40-yard return) and one blocked punt as a junior ... As a senior he had 68 tackles, three TFLs and one blocked punt .. A captain as a senior, he was a member of the all-region team ... Also played baseball and was on the All-Tournament team at the Baseball at the Beach ... He also played in the All-Star game ... A Sonic Scholar-Athlete Award winner ...
Personal: Born Feb. 6, 1992 in Spartanburg, S.C. ... FUlle name is Cannon Charles Jordan ... Parents are Chuck and Pat Jordan ... Father played football and ran track from 1975-1979 ... Majoring in Mathematics.
